Job Description - Senior Corporate Counsel - Labor & Employment


ALDI is a fast-growing retailer, and our Legal team plays a critical role in supporting how we scale-by identifying risk early, advising with practical, business-focused guidance, and helping drive smart, efficient outcomes. In this full-time Legal hybrid role located in Aurora, IL (in-office at least 2 days per month), you'll join a collaborative team of experienced practitioners and directly support corporate leadership with legal matters that impact day-to-day operations and long-term growth.

In this role, the Senior Counsel - Labor & Employment will serve as a trusted advisor to leadership-proactively identifying risk, guiding strategic decisions, and driving best-in-class legal practices across the organization. This position offers the opportunity to own complex matters from pre-litigation strategy through resolution, influence policy development, and collaborate cross-functionally to support ALDI's continued growth. If you're a results-driven attorney who thrives on autonomy, values practical problem-solving, and is energized by partnering with the business to deliver forward-thinking solutions, this role offers a unique platform to make a meaningful impact.



 

Position Type: Full-Time
Starting Salary: $186,250
Salary Increases: Year 2 - $196,750 | Year 3 - $207,000
Work Location: Aurora, IL
This role is eligible to participate in ALDI's Legal Hybrid Work Program, which requires work in-office at least 2 days per month.

Education and Experience:

 


• Bachelor's Degree required.

• A minimum of 5 years of progressive experience in a legal environment required.

• Experience in a law firm, corporate legal department or in-house legal counsel required.

• J.D. required from an ABA accredited law school; licensed to practice in Illinois (or immediate ability to become licensed) required.

• Knowledge of contract law, data privacy, litigation, employment law and/or commercial disputes required.
